10 Thoughts on... Invincible Presents: Atom Eve and Rex Splode Vol. 1

Hey, it's a 10 Thoughts post! Yeah, that's as much of an intro as I have...

Invincible Presents: Atom Eve and Rex Splode Volume One. Collecting Invincible Presents: Atom Eve #1-2 & Invincible Presents: Atom Eve and Rex Splode #1-3... Phew!

Synopsis: Basically this trade fills us in on what Rex and Eve were up to before the events of Invincible #1. There, how's THAT for a synopsis!

Score: 9 out of 10. Super solid trade, that gives insight into two of the supporting characters in the Invincible books. If you don't read Invincible, you probably wouldn't care for this trade, but if you do read Invincible, it's definitely worth a look.
